CBD for dogs: Key benefits for natural pet wellness

CBD for dogs is becoming increasingly popular among pet owner, and provide additional wellness benefits. Pet owners are increasingly looking for natural treatments for their pets. Made from hemp, cannabidiol (CBD) provides a natural way for owners to treat their dogs, which they believe helps improve a dog’s quality of life. CBD is non-psychoactive (unlike THC), which makes it a much safer option for pets when it’s both sourced responsibly and administered responsibly.

 

One of the primary reasons that pet parents turn to CBD for dogs is because of its ability to alleviate pain and induce a state of calm. Many senior dogs suffer from joint stiffness, limited mobility or long-term pain, and it can significantly lower their quality of life. Early studies indicate that CBD can help minimize inflammation, the aches and pains of a pet’s activity, such as for older pets or those with arthritis. It can be used to complement care plans, but should not be substituted for veterinary treatment.

 

One of the other prominent ways in which CBD has made a name for itself is in stress relief. Just like people, dogs suffer from anxiety, whether because of separation, noise, or other issues. Conventional calming supplements can sometimes miss the mark, making pet owners turn to natural products instead. According to reports, CBD engages with the endocannabinoid system that oversees mood and stress response. This makes it a possible treatment for balancing a dog’s emotions without a high degree of sedation.

 

Digestive health is another consideration. Dogs with sensitive stomachs or wonky appetites will appreciate the gentle effects of CBD oil. It may also help to balance the gut and subsequently help to support healthier eating habits and alleviate occasional nausea. But it has to be done gingerly, based on the size, weight and condition of the patient. It is always better to consult with a vet before administering CBD to verify safety and efficacy.

 

It’s important to evaluate quality when choosing dog CBD products. You’ll want it to be organically grown, pesticide-free, and third-party tested for purity. Pet-specific products are preferred as they frequently have dog-friendly flavours and pre-packaged doses. Oils, soft chews, and capsules are popular delivery methods, all of which provide different levels of convenience and absorption.

 

While the science is still in its early stages, anecdotal evidence provided by pet owners is proliferating. A lot of users would say that they have better comfort, relaxation and energy. Still, every dog is different, which is why you should always introduce slowly and monitor carefully.
